Low Sugar Jam or Jelly: Lasts 8-9 Months with refrigeration. It is not recommended that low-sugar jam and jelly be left unrefrigerated after opening, as reduced sugar will not preserve sufficiently. Sugar-Free Jam or Jelly: Lasts 6-9 Months with refrigeration. It should be refrigerated after opening because it does not have the preservative ... Not if it was properly processed for room temperature storage in the first place. i.e. there are "refrigerator pickle" and "refrigerator jam" recipes that are never intended to be stored at room temperature, and do not have appropriate recipes or processing for room temperature storage. Bacteria can grow quickly on any food left out at room temperature, and can lead to food poisoning. It is important to note that even though food may still look, smell and taste okay, it can still have dangerous levels of contamination.
